The West Cliff area of Ramsgate is a scenic and historically rich part of this seaside town on the Kent coast. It’s known for its elevated position, offering stunning views over the English Channel and the Royal Harbour, which is the only royal-designated harbour in the UK.
What’s it like?
West Cliff feels a little more tranquil and residential compared to the busier town centre or seafront. The area is lined with Victorian and Georgian townhouses, some converted into apartments, mixed with more modern homes. There's a laid-back charm, especially along the cliffside promenade, which stretches along the top of the cliffs with panoramic sea views.
Key Features:
West Cliff Promenade: A long, open stretch perfect for walks, especially at sunset.
Royal Esplanade: A leafy avenue with period architecture and a peaceful atmosphere.
King George VI Memorial Park: A lovely green space with Italianate gardens and a little café, popular with dog walkers.
Granville Theatre: A small, local theatre right by the seafront (currently closed for redevelopment).
Pegwell Bay Views: At the far western end, you can glimpse the start of the more rugged coastline towards Pegwell Bay.
Vibes:
The whole area has a slightly faded grandeur — you can imagine how posh it must have been in its heyday — but now it feels more chilled and a bit bohemian. It’s a favourite spot for locals to escape the more touristy parts of Ramsgate.
Who would love it?
Walkers and nature lovers
People looking for sea views without the crowds
Those into a bit of local history and architecture
Anyone after a quiet, slower-paced part of Ramsgate
If you're thinking of visiting or moving there, West Cliff has that coastal calm with just the right amount of character.
Ramsgate, a coastal town in Kent, England, is well connected by various transport options. Here are some common ways to travel there:
By Train
From London: Direct trains run from London St Pancras International (high-speed service, about 1 hour 15 minutes) and London Victoria (around 1 hour 50 minutes).
From Other Locations: Trains also connect Ramsgate to Canterbury, Ashford, Margate, and Dover via Southeastern Railway.
By Car
From London, take the M2 motorway and then the A299 (Thanet Way) towards Ramsgate. The journey takes about 1 hour 45 minutes, depending on traffic.
There are parking facilities in and around the town.
By Coach/Bus
National Express operates coaches from London Victoria Coach Station to Ramsgate, taking around 2.5 to 3 hours.
Local bus services connect Ramsgate with other Kent towns like Margate, Broadstairs, Canterbury, and Dover.
By Ferry (Nearby Ports)
While Ramsgate Port does not currently have passenger ferries, you can travel via Dover (20 miles away), which offers ferry routes to Calais, France.
From Dover, you can drive or take a train/bus to Ramsgate.
By Air
The nearest major airport is London Gatwick (about 1.5–2 hours away by car or train).
London City Airport and Heathrow are also options, with train or car connections to Ramsgate.
